About
Player bio
All games
- 62% Win percentage
- 851 Wins
- 503 Losses
- 1565 Average Elo
- 252 Tournaments
- 276 Results
- 1354 Matches
Super Smash Bros. Ultimate
- 63% Win percentage
- 851 Wins
- 499 Losses
- 2228 Current Elo
- 252 Tournaments
- 274 Results
- 1350 Matches
Super Smash Bros. Melee
- 0% Win percentage
- 0 Wins
- 4 Losses
- 902 Current Elo
- 1 Tournaments
- 2 Results
- 4 Matches